Overview

Solana and Avalanche are both high-performance Layer 1 blockchains positioning as Ethereum alternatives, but with different architectures.

Head-to-Head Comparison

Consensus

Solana: Proof of History + Proof of Stake. Single-chain monolithic design. Avalanche: Avalanche Consensus across three chains (X, P, C). Subnet architecture.

Performance

  • Solana: 65,000 TPS theoretical, 400ms finality
  • Avalanche: 4,500 TPS on C-Chain, sub-second finality

DeFi Ecosystem

Solana has larger TVL; Avalanche has more EVM compatibility.

When to Choose Each

Solana: Want maximum speed, large DeFi ecosystem Avalanche: Prefer EVM compatibility, subnet flexibility

Risk Analysis

Solana has had network outages; Avalanche is more stable but smaller ecosystem.

Verdict

Solana for speed and ecosystem size; Avalanche for EVM compatibility and subnets.
